(European Conservative) Neukölln’s integration officer has warned that “Islamists and activists” have infiltrated parts of the Social Democratic Party of Germany (SPD). She claims they, with support from some left-wing groups, contributed to the downfall of district mayor Martin Hikel.
Güner Balci told Der Spiegel that Hikel has been under attack for ten years by a persistent left-wing faction. She described the influence as linked to the Muslim Brotherhood and alleged that some groups operate as supposedly independent non-governmental organizations (NGOs) under government surveillance.
The mayor has faced criticism for his stance on criminal clans, with party members disputing his use of the term and accusing him of ignoring such issues as “anti-Muslim racism.”
